Linda Lou Everding was born January 3, 1945 in Adamcenter, NY to Carl and Mable (Hunter) Everding. She graduated from North Central High School in Rogers, ND in 1963.
On August 8, 1963, Linda married Randolph James Hayes in Sanborn, ND. They lived in Jamestown, ND where Randy worked for the Coca-Cola bottling company. Later they owned and operated a bar in Luverne, ND for 10 years. In 1983, they moved to Mandan, ND as Randy started working with Schwan’s Frozen Foods. They relocated to Murdo, SD in 1988.
After Randy’s passing in 1996, Linda lived in Valley City and Aberdeen before moving to Faulkton in 2005.
She enjoyed spending her time gardening, camping, crocheting and painting ceramics. While living at the Faulkton Senior Living, Linda enjoyed bingo and getting her hair and nails done.
Linda is survived by her son, Cory (Melissa) of Faulkton; two daughters: Laurie (Bill) Frazier of Bath and Annette (Jeff) Lefforge of Mansfield; five grandchildren: Dustin (Natasha) Hayes of Faulkton, Mitch Friedt of Aberdeen, and Hayden, Savanna and Collin Hayes of Faulkton; two great grandchildren: Peyton and Axel Hayes of Faulkton; two sisters: Marie (Laurel) Gunderson of Lynnwood, WA and Barb Olson of Valley City, ND; and one brother, Ray (Tita) Everding of Warner Robins, GA.
She was preceded in death by her parents; husband; and grandparents, Fred and Rose Hunter.
